About the role:
We are looking for an experienced and creative Store Design & Visual Merchandising Manager to join our Brand Scenography team within the Global Marketing department. In this role, you will lead the development of global Store Design and Visual Merchandising concepts to ensure a strong, consistent, and premium brand expression across all retail touchpoints worldwide.
As part of the Brand Scenography department, you will also manage a team and collaborate closely with Retail teams and international markets.
Job responsibilities
Your missions :
Global Store Design & Brand Experience:
- Develop global Store Design concepts aligned with the Maison’s brand identity and marketing strategy.
- Create and oversee retail environments including boutiques, pop-ups, shop‑in‑shops, exhibitions, and temporary activations.
- Ensure immersive brand experiences across all retail formats, consistent with the Maison’s creative vision.
- Lead customer journey development, storytelling, and product presentation across all touchpoints.
Visual Merchandising Strategy & Campaign Deployment:
- Define and implement global VM guidelines and standards.
- Translate marketing campaigns into VM activations and impactful in‑store experiences.
- Ensure consistent VM execution across markets while enabling relevant local adaptations.
- Collaborate with regional teams to support global VM deployment.
Innovation & Trend Monitoring:
- Monitor global trends in luxury retail, architecture, design, and immersive customer experiences.
- Propose innovative concepts and creative solutions to continuously elevate the Maison’s retail expression worldwide.
- Explore new materials and technologies to enhance brand visibility, engagement, and experiential impact.
International Planning & Project Management:
- Lead global planning and rollout of Store Design and VM projects across all regions.
- Manage timelines, budgets, and partners to ensure seamless project execution.
- Oversee multiple international projects while maintaining high quality and brand consistency.
- Partner with internal and external stakeholders to deliver projects from concept to completion.
Team Management & Cross-Functional Collaboration:
- Lead and develop the team by providing guidance, coaching, and performance support.
- Set priorities and structure workflows to ensure efficient processes and high‑quality creative output.
- Foster a collaborative and creative culture that drives innovation and operational excellence.
- Partner with Global Marketing, Product, Retail, and Regional teams to ensure alignment and seamless execution of brand initiatives and launches.
Profile
Desired Profil:
- Degree in Architecture, Interior Design, Visual Merchandising, Scenography, or a related field.
- Minimum 8 years of experience in Store Design, Visual Merchandising, or Retail Design within the luxury or premium industry.
- Strong experience developing global retail concepts and managing international rollouts.
- Proven experience managing and developing creative teams.
- Strong understanding of global brand image and luxury customer experience.
- Ability to combine creative vision with strong operational and project management skills.
-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ills in an international environment.
- Fluent in English; additional languages are a plus.
- Strong sensitivity to luxury, ideally within watchmaking, jewelry, fashion, or premium lifestyle brands.
